public final class CommandLine
extends java.lang.Object
Command line options can be defined beforehand, the command line be parsed and set options be queried. It is possible to print a short usage message.
Note one can use --
to end the list of command line options.
This is used if an argument bears a name of a command line option.
CommandLine cl = new CommandLine(); cl.addOption("-help", null, "Print usage"); cl.addOption("-noArg", null, "Parameter w/o argument"); cl.addOption("-argument", "argname", "Parameter w/ argument"); // public static void main(String[] args) : cl.parse(args); if (cl.isSet(CMDLINE_HELP)) { cl.printUsage(System.out); System.exit(0); } if (cl.isSet("-noArg")) { // do something } // retrieve a set value String s = cl.getString("-argument", "default value if not set"); // or retrieve a set integer value // this throws a CommandLineException if not formatted as an integer int intVal = cl.getInteger("-argument", 42); list = cl.getArguments(); // handle remaining arguments
